The evaluation process starts with a comprehensive document review. UNIHF requires suppliers to submit bank statements, tax records, and business licenses going back at least three years. They cross-check these against Hong Kong’s Companies Registry to verify legal standing. For manufacturing partners, they demand detailed production flowcharts, raw material sourcing lists, and sub-supplier contracts. In 2024, UNIHF rejected 8 out of 20 applicants because of discrepancies in their documentation—things like missing environmental permits or inconsistent financial reports. The document audit also includes a technical capability assessment. Suppliers must provide samples of similar products they’ve made for other clients, along with test reports from accredited labs. UNIHF’s engineering team reviews these for tolerances, material composition, and durability. For instance, when evaluating a PCB supplier, they check for IPC-A-600 compliance and solder joint quality. They also require suppliers to disclose their failure analysis procedures. If a supplier can’t show how they handle defects, they’re automatically disqualified. This upfront filtering saves time and money. According to UNIHF’s 2023 annual report, the document review phase alone reduced the supplier pool by 60%, cutting down on wasted inspection trips.
Once documents pass, the next step is the on-site factory audit. UNIHF sends a team of two to four inspectors, often including a quality engineer and a supply chain specialist. They typically spend two to three days at the facility. The audit covers five key areas: production equipment, workforce training, quality control processes, inventory management, and safety protocols. Inspectors use a standardized checklist with over 150 items. For example, they check if CNC machines are calibrated within the last six months, if workers have proper PPE, and if there’s a documented traceability system for raw materials. They also conduct random product sampling—pulling 20 to 30 units from the production line and testing them against UNIHF’s specifications. In one audit in Shenzhen, inspectors found that a supplier’s humidity control system was malfunctioning, causing inconsistent solder paste performance. That supplier was given 30 days to fix the issue and submit a corrective action report. UNIHF follows up with a second audit to verify compliance. Data from 2024 shows that 35% of suppliers fail their initial on-site audit, but 70% of those pass after remediation. The ones that don’t are dropped from the roster.
Performance metrics are the backbone of ongoing supplier evaluation. UNIHF uses a real-time dashboard that tracks key indicators like on-time delivery, defect rate, lead time variability, and response time to inquiries. They update this data weekly. Suppliers are ranked into four tiers: A, B, C, and D. Tier A suppliers get priority for new orders and longer payment terms. Tier D suppliers are put on probation and may be removed if they don’t improve within three months. In 2024, UNIHF’s top 10 suppliers (all Tier A) had an average defect rate of 0.15% and a delivery performance of 98.5%. In contrast, Tier C suppliers had a defect rate of 1.2% and a delivery rate of 89%. The company also uses a supplier scorecard that combines quantitative data with qualitative feedback from procurement and engineering teams. For instance, if a supplier consistently misses deadlines but has excellent product quality, they might get a lower score on delivery but still be retained if they’re the only source for a critical component. UNIHF reviews these scorecards quarterly with senior management. They also benchmark suppliers against industry standards from sources like the Hong Kong Productivity Council. This data-driven approach helps UNIHF identify risks early. In 2023, they flagged a supplier whose defect rate jumped from 0.2% to 0.8% in two months. An investigation revealed a change in their raw material supplier, which was quickly corrected.
Compliance and ethical standards are non-negotiable in UNIHF’s evaluation. They require all suppliers to sign a code of conduct that covers labor rights, environmental practices, and anti-corruption. UNIHF conducts random audits to check for violations like child labor, excessive overtime, or improper waste disposal. In 2023, they terminated a contract with a supplier in Dongguan after finding that workers were working 72-hour weeks without overtime pay. They also use third-party auditors from firms like SGS or TÜV Rheinland for high-risk suppliers. Environmental compliance is particularly strict for suppliers dealing with chemicals or heavy metals. UNIHF requires them to submit waste management plans and proof of proper disposal. They also check for compliance with REACH and RoHS regulations. For suppliers in the electronics sector, they audit for conflict mineral sourcing. UNIHF’s 2024 sustainability report shows that 92% of their active suppliers passed these compliance audits, up from 85% in 2022. They also have a whistleblower system where employees or suppliers can report violations anonymously. This has led to three investigations in the past two years, resulting in one supplier being removed and two being issued warnings.
Cost evaluation is more than just comparing price quotes. UNIHF uses a total cost of ownership (TCO) model that factors in shipping, tariffs, inventory holding costs, and potential quality-related expenses. For example, a supplier in Vietnam might offer a unit price 15% lower than a Hong Kong-based competitor, but when you add in longer lead times, higher shipping costs, and the risk of customs delays, the TCO might be 5% higher. UNIHF’s procurement team calculates TCO for every major purchase. They also negotiate price breaks based on volume and contract length. In 2024, they secured a 12% discount from a Tier A supplier by committing to a two-year contract. But they don’t just look at price—they also evaluate cost stability. Suppliers that frequently change prices or add surcharges get lower scores. UNIHF tracks price volatility over time. For instance, one supplier increased prices by 8% in six months due to raw material fluctuations. That supplier was moved from Tier B to Tier C. The company also uses a bidding process for large contracts, but only pre-qualified suppliers can participate. In 2023, they ran a tender for a custom sensor component, and 14 suppliers bid. The winning bid wasn’t the lowest price—it was the one with the best TCO and a proven track record of quality.
Technology integration plays a big role in how UNIHF evaluates suppliers. They use a supplier relationship management (SRM) system that connects to suppliers’ ERP systems for real-time data sharing. This allows them to track production progress, inventory levels, and shipment status without manual updates. Suppliers that can integrate their systems with UNIHF’s get a 10% bonus in their evaluation score. In 2024, 60% of UNIHF’s suppliers were using some form of digital integration. The SRM system also automates quality checks. For example, when a shipment arrives, the system compares the delivered items against the purchase order and flags any discrepancies. If the defect rate exceeds a threshold, the system automatically triggers a hold and notifies the quality team. UNIHF also uses AI to predict supplier risks. The system analyzes historical data, news reports, and economic indicators to flag potential issues like labor strikes, natural disasters, or financial instability. In 2023, the AI flagged a supplier in Thailand that was at risk of flooding during monsoon season. UNIHF preemptively shifted orders to another supplier, avoiding a two-week delay. This predictive capability has reduced supply chain disruptions by 25% since 2022.

Risk management is woven into every stage of the evaluation. UNIHF uses a risk matrix that scores suppliers on financial health, geopolitical exposure, natural disaster risk, and supply chain concentration. For example, if a supplier is the sole source for a critical component, their risk score is automatically higher. UNIHF then requires that supplier to maintain a safety stock of 30 days’ worth of inventory. They also diversify their supplier base for high-risk items. In 2024, they identified that 40% of their microcontrollers came from a single supplier in Taiwan. They brought on a second supplier in South Korea, reducing that concentration to 25%. The company also conducts stress tests—simulating scenarios like a factory fire or a trade embargo—to see how their supply chain would hold up. In one test, they found that losing a key supplier in Malaysia would cause a 45-day delay for a product line. They responded by stockpiling critical components and developing alternative sourcing options. These risk assessments are updated quarterly, and any supplier with a risk score above 70% is flagged for immediate review. In 2023, 5 suppliers were put on a watchlist, and 2 were replaced.
